コース詳細
- Policy Analysis and Evaluation
- Decision Making in Public Policy
- Policy Implementation Strategies
- Monitoring and Evaluation of Policy Impact
- Stakeholder Management in Policy Implementation
- Public Management and Leadership
- Policy Communication and Public Engagement
- Ethical Considerations in Policy Implementation
- Legal Aspects of Policy Implementation

As a professional career path and data visualization expert, I've created a 3D pie chart showcasing the job market trends for those holding a Graduate Certificate in Policy Implementation and Decision Making in the UK.
This chart will help you understand the demand for specific roles and their respective salary ranges. 1. Policy Analyst: Representing 35% of the market, Policy Analysts are in high demand, focusing on evaluating policies and recommending improvements to government agencies and non-profit organizations.
Salaries typically range from £28,000 to £45,000. 2. Government Program Manager: Holding 25% of the market, Government Program Managers are responsible for the successful planning, implementation, and coordination of public programs.
Their salaries usually fall between £32,000 and £60,000. 3. Public Affairs Specialist: With a 20% market share, Public Affairs Specialists build and maintain positive relationships between organizations and the government, with salaries ranging from £28,000 to £50,000. 4. Policy Consultant: Representation in the job market at 15%, Policy Consultants advise businesses and government agencies on how to navigate complex policy landscapes, with salaries typically ranging from £35,000 to £70,000. 5. Legislative Assistant: Holding the remaining 5% of the market, Legislative Assistants support policymakers by conducting research, organizing meetings, and drafting documents, with salaries ranging from £22,000 to £30,000.
